DENVER, Oct. 28, 2024 ~ High 5 Plumbing, Heating, Cooling & Electric has once again proven their dedication to growth and excellence as they have been named one of Denver's fastest-growing companies for the second year in a row. The family-owned and operated home service company has secured the No. 7 spot in the small business category on the Denver Business Journal's Fast 50 rankings.
The Fast 50 list recognizes the top private companies in the Denver area that have shown significant growth over the past year. High 5 Plumbing, Heating, Cooling & Electric has consistently demonstrated their commitment to expansion and improvement, making them a well-deserved recipient of this prestigious recognition.
Co-owner Levi Torres expressed his gratitude for the community and their team's contributions to their success, stating, "We are always looking to grow and improve... We've built a great team here that has allowed us to expand our offerings, and the community is always there to support us. We plan on keeping the pedal down for many years to come."

This latest achievement adds to High 5's impressive list of accomplishments in 2024. In August, they were named to the Inc. 5000 for the third consecutive year as one of America's fastest-growing private companies. This year, they ranked at No. 1,812 overall, moving up over 100 spots from last year's ranking.
In addition to these recognitions, High 5 also launched two new essential services this year - their HVAC division in April and their electrical division in September. With these additions, High 5 now offers a full suite of home services for homeowners in the greater Denver metropolitan area.
